DS Waters Water Filtration Units
Overview
UH entered into a contract with DS
Waters (DBA Sparkletts) to provide
water filtration units for
$17.99/month plus an annual charge
of $25.00 to change the filter.
Also, UH Plumbing must approve the
proposed location of the filtration
unit before installation and inspect
the unit after it is installed.
Steps for Requesting a Water
Filtration Unit
1. Requesting department submits
billable work request to PlantOps
Customer Service, including cost
center to be charged, for the UH
Plumbing Shop to approve/inspect the
installation of the water filtration
unit. Specify the proposed location
of the unit(s).
2. Customer Service notifies the
requesting department of the work
request number and forwards the work
request to the UH Plumbing Shop.
3. Requesting department submits
DS
Waters Order Form to DS
Waters and includes work request
number on Order Form.
4. Plumbing Shop will coordinate
with DS Waters to locate water tap
within 48 hours of receiving the
work request, provided the Plumbing
Shop is not busy with a campus
plumbing emergency.
5. DS Waters installs unit within 24
hours of being notified by Plumbing
Shop of approved location.
6. DS Waters notifies the Plumbing
Shop that installation is complete.
7. Plumbing Shop inspects installed
water filtration unit and notifies
PlantOps Customer Service that unit
is okay.
8. Customer Service notifies the
requesting department that the unit
is safe to use. These steps are also summarized in a
flowchart.
Water Filtration Units vs. Bottled
Water Dispensers
� Water filtration units use the
building�s water supply. Bottled
water dispensers use plastic
bottles, which are difficult to
handle and bad for the environment.
� Water filtration units are less
expensive than bottled water
dispensers. Water dispensers average
$12/month plus $5/bottle. Water
filtration units are a fixed price
per month regardless of use. See
scenarios below. Scenario 1:
Department uses a
bottled water dispenser and consumes
1 bottle of water per day.
$12 + ($5 * 20 days) = $112/month *
12 months = $1,344/year.
Scenario 2:
Department uses a DS
Waters water filtration unit.
($17.99/month * 12 months) + $25 for
filter = $240.88/year + $50
estimated one-time charge for UH
Plumbing to inspect unit. That�s a
savings of over $1,000/year compared
to a bottled water dispenser!
Additional Information about DS
Waters Water Filtration Units
� See the water filtration units
here.
� PO not required to request a water
filtration unit (follow the steps
above).
� Payment can be made by P-Card
(preferred) or voucher.
� Use account 53500, Rental �
Equipment, when paying for rental of
water filtration units.
� No minimum rental period.
� If you want to stop renting the
filtration unit, send an email to
Naomi Alfred at DS Waters (nalfred@water.com)
and DS Waters will remove the unit
within 60 days. There is no penalty
but you must continue to pay for the
unit until it is removed by DS
Waters.
